Xcode 11.4.1 Release Notes
Update your apps to use new features, and test your apps against API changes.
Overview
Xcode 11.4.1 includes SDKs for iOS 13.4, iPadOS 13.4, tvOS 13.4, watchOS 6.2, and macOS Catalina 10.15.4. The Xcode 11.4.1 release supports on-device debugging for iOS 8 and later, tvOS 9 and later, and watchOS 2 and later. Xcode 11.4.1 requires a Mac running macOS Catalina 10.15.2 or later.

Asset Catalog
Known Issues
iOS apps with asset catalogs built with Xcode 11.4 may experience slower image loading performance in Dark Mode when deployed to devices running iOS 13.3 or earlier. (61200701) (FB7648891)
Workaround: Add a symbol glyph to the app’s asset catalog.

Signing and Distribution
Known Issues
Automatic signing may fail to make changes to app IDs that use a seed prefix and not a team ID prefix. (59672760) (FB7593038)
Workaround: Adjust your app ID manually on the Apple Developer website, then return to Xcode to generate a provisioning profile.

Swift Packages
Resolved Issues
Fixed an issue where an error like “Swift package product A is linked as a static library by B and C. This will result in duplication of library code.” was incorrectly emitted if an app and an embedded app extension or helper tool statically linked the same package product. If you previously set the
DISABLE_DIAMOND_PROBLEM_DIAGNOSTICbuild setting to work around this issue, you can delete this setting now. (59310009, 61227255)
